Case Perspective 1: From Activity Overload to Strategic Focus

The Situation

A growing SME had invested heavily in digital marketing.

Multiple agencies.

Numerous campaigns.

High content output.

Despite this, leadership felt:

  • Messaging was inconsistent
  • Budgets were fragmented
  • Performance reporting lacked clarity
  • Growth was slower than expected

The Intervention

Through structured SME marketing strategy development:

  • Target markets were narrowed
  • Value proposition was clarified
  • Underperforming channels were removed
  • KPIs were redefined
  • Agency relationships were restructured

The Outcome

Within 12 months:

  • Marketing spend reduced
  • Lead quality improved
  • Sales conversion strengthened
  • Leadership confidence increased

The shift was not about doing more.

It was about doing less, better.

Case Perspective 4: Aligning Marketing and Sales for Sustainable Growth

The Situation

An SME with ambitious growth targets experienced friction between sales and marketing.

Sales wanted more leads.

Marketing wanted more budget.

Finance wanted more accountability.

There was activity — but limited cohesion.

The Intervention

Strategic mentoring addressed:

  • Shared revenue targets
  • Clear lead qualification criteria
  • Joint KPI framework
  • Improved reporting transparency
  • Alignment workshops at leadership level

The Outcome

Within a structured framework:

  • Lead quality improved
  • Sales pipeline became more predictable
  • Internal tension reduced
  • Marketing investment decisions improved

Alignment reduced noise and increased performance.
